General: Google Earth Mystery


A couple of weeks ago we posted a mystery image from Google Earth. In fact it showed the shadows of trees cast on the River Thames in London, clearly the sun was low in the sky though the shadow shows the sun was still in the south. What could this tell us about the time of year it was taken? (Over to you year 9!). It should also remind us that these are images and not maps. Year 6 may want to think about the differences.

It's the World, but not as we know it!!


The map above was taken from the Worldmapper web site. On this site you can see many images of the World distorted to show information. The example above is of World Population and each country is the correct size for its populaton rather than its land area. Can you see any surprises? Perhaps you can explore the site and send us comments back on what catches your attention.

General: The man from the OS


Ever wondered how the Ordnance Survey keep their maps up to date? Today the man from the OS arrived to survey our new school building. He was using the ultimate in GPS systems accurate to a few mm. One problem though; the roof overhang was getting in the way of the satellites. We can look forward now to our school appearing as it now is on future maps of the area.
